Lines Matching refs:sig_len

91 			  const uint32_t sig_len, const uint32_t key_len,  in rsa_mod_exp_hw()  argument
95 uint8_t sig_reverse[sig_len]; in rsa_mod_exp_hw()
96 uint8_t buf[sig_len]; in rsa_mod_exp_hw()
142 for (i = 0; i < sig_len; i++) in rsa_mod_exp_hw()
143 sig_reverse[sig_len-1-i] = sig[i]; in rsa_mod_exp_hw()
155 for (i = 0; i < sig_len; i++) in rsa_mod_exp_hw()
156 sig_reverse[sig_len-1-i] = buf[i]; in rsa_mod_exp_hw()
158 memcpy(output, sig_reverse, sig_len); in rsa_mod_exp_hw()
398 const uint32_t sig_len, const uint8_t *hash, in rsa_verify_key() argument
409 if (sig_len != (prop->num_bits / 8)) { in rsa_verify_key()
410 debug("Signature is of incorrect length %d\n", sig_len); in rsa_verify_key()
417 if (sig_len > RSA_MAX_SIG_BITS / 8) { in rsa_verify_key()
418 debug("Signature length %u exceeds maximum %d\n", sig_len, in rsa_verify_key()
423 uint8_t buf[sig_len]; in rsa_verify_key()
427 ret = rsa_mod_exp_hw(prop, sig, sig_len, key_len, buf); in rsa_verify_key()
437 ret = rsa_mod_exp(mod_exp_dev, sig, sig_len, prop, buf); in rsa_verify_key()
440 ret = rsa_mod_exp_sw(sig, sig_len, prop, buf); in rsa_verify_key()
529 uint sig_len, int node) in rsa_verify_with_keynode() argument
536 return rsa_verify_key(info, &prop, sig, sig_len, hash, in rsa_verify_with_keynode()
542 uint8_t *sig, uint sig_len) in rsa_verify() argument
579 ret = rsa_verify_with_keynode(info, hash, sig, sig_len, in rsa_verify()
588 ret = rsa_verify_with_keynode(info, hash, sig, sig_len, node); in rsa_verify()
597 ret = rsa_verify_with_keynode(info, hash, sig, sig_len, in rsa_verify()